The bride, for that one day is the most beautiful woman in the room, and therefore she is the target of a lot of envy, and so a lot of these designs and the henna itself are there to protect her against this envy which can be very dangerous to her. Indian henna designs contain a lot of symbols that will help the bride. For example, there's a lot of paisleys in Indian henna designs. Paisleys are a fertility symbol because they resemble a mango and a mango is a fertility symbol because of the big seed inside. And there are also a lot of peacocks in Indian designs. Peacocks symbolize happiness and that's something every bride wants. There's a tradition in Indian bridal henna where the groom's initials are drawn into the design, and on the wedding night the groom has to try and find the initials and its said that if he can't find the initials the bride will have the upper hand in the marriage. And if he can find his initials, he will have the upper hand, so it's always in the bride's best interest in order to keep her power to get a very good henna artist who can hide the initials very well. Middle eastern Jews also have a henna party before their weddings. There's a lot of dancing and singing and henna comes into play and the bride and the groom each get a smear of henna in their palm for good luck."
